- The distance between Sejmcan, Russia and Mumbai/ Bombay, India is approximately 7,619 km or 4,735 mi.
- To reach Sejmcan in this distance one would set out from Mumbai/ Bombay bearing 28.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Sejmcan bearing 89.7° or E .
- Sejmcan has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c) whereas Mumbai/ Bombay has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- The average temperature is 38.8 °C (69.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 46.6 °C (83.9°F) more in Sejmcan.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1857.2 mm (73.1 in) less which is equivalent to 1857.2 l/m² (45.58 US gal/ft²) or 18,572,000 l/ha (1,985,470 US gal/ac) less. About 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 42.6° lower in Sejmcan than in Mumbai/ Bombay.
